Types of Cat Flaps
Before hiring a professional installer, pet owners must investigate the kinds of cat flaps offered. The following table compares different choices:
| Type of Cat Flap | Description | Benefits | Disadvantages |
|---|---|---|---|
| Manual Flap | Basic, non-electronic flap | Affordable and simple to install | Less safe and secure and may enable other animals in |
| Magnetic Flap | Flap held by magnets, needs a collar magnet | More secure, avoids undesirable entry | Collar may be uncomfortable for some cats |
| Electronic Flap | Utilizes a sensing unit to open for a particular cat's collar | Extremely safe, regulated access | Greater cost and might require batteries/interface |
| Microchip-Activated Flap | Utilizes the pet's microchip for access | Really protected, no collar required | Preliminary setup might be made complex |
The Installation Process
The installation of a cat flap can be an uncomplicated procedure when managed by specialists. Here's a basic outline of what to anticipate:
Consultation
- The installer will talk about the pet owner's needs and assess the best place for the cat flap.
Selection of Flap
- Based upon the assessment, the installer will assist pick the appropriate type of flap.
Measurement
- Accurate measurements are important for a correct fit to prevent gaps that might enable drafts or burglars.
Preparation of the Door/Wall
- The installer prepares the door or wall, marking the cut area, and may require power tools for the task.
Installation
- The cat flap is suited the prepared area, secured, and lined up for optimal operation.
Final Adjustments
- After installation, the installer will guarantee everything is working effectively and make any essential adjustments.
Consumer Instruction
- The professional will offer ideas for your pet's acclimatization with the new flap, maximizing its effectiveness.

Frequently Asked Questions About Cat Flap Installation
1. Can any door have a cat flap installed?
Yes, most doors can have a cat flap installed, however the installer will examine the viability based upon product and thickness.
2. How long does the installation procedure take?
Generally, installing a cat flap takes one to two hours, depending on the intricacy and kind of door.
3. Will my pet easily find out to utilize the cat flap?
The majority of family pets adjust quickly, specifically with proper motivation, such as deals with or toys used as incentives.

5. Can I set up a cat flap in a wall instead of a door?
Yes, cat flaps can also be installed in walls. However, this frequently requires additional work and may be more pricey.
6. Exists a specific time to install a cat flap?
The timing is usually up to the pet owner; however, carrying out the installation when the weather is moderate can help assist in the adjustment duration for animals.
